The Bootleg Cocktail 1 Picture

Ingredients

  • Bootleg Mix:
  • 1/2 cup fresh lemon juice (about 3 large lemons, juiced)
  • 1/4 cup fresh lime juice (4 to 5 small limes, juiced) or additional lemon juice
  • 1/4 cup light agave nectar or cane sugar or honey*
  • 2 packed tablespoons fresh mint leaves
  • Per drink (note: 2 ounces is 1/4 cup):
  • 2 ounces bootleg mix
  • 2 ounces gin, vodka or bourbon
  • 2 ounces club soda

Preparation

Step 1

To make the bootleg mix: Juice the lemons and limes into a liquid measuring cup. Add sweetener. Pour the juice and sweetener into a blender. Add 2 firmly packed tablespoons of fresh mint leaves. Blend thoroughly, until the mint is is broken into teeny tiny bits.
To make the drinks: Fill cocktail glasses with ice. For each drink, pour in 2 ounces of your bootleg mix, plus 2 ounces of your liquor of choice and top with 2 ounces club soda. Serve with a straw, which doubles as a stirring device.

NOTES
Recipe inspired by Brit's Pub in Minneapolis. Recipe created with guidance from The Bootleg: Minnesota's signature country-club cocktail on City Pages.
*I ran out of agave nectar as I was making these drinks, so I used 2 tablespoons agave nectar and 2 tablespoons cane sugar. You could also use honey, but your drinks will have a strong honey flavor. I preferred a more neutral sweetener here.
STORAGE TIP: The bootleg mix will keep for a couple of days in the refrigerator, but is best served immediately.
